SAM7X/XC

Deterministic Flash MCU Offers Ethernet, CAN, USB and Hardware Cryptography Features
Atmel® SAM7X/XC ARM7TDMI® Flash MCU offer power and flexibility, delivering a cost-effective solution for extensively networked, real-time embedded systems. They feature embedded high-speed Flash and SRAM, a large set of standard peripherals, plus a USB 2.0 Device, a 10/100 Ethernet MAC and a CAN controller. To optimize performance, dedicated peripheral DMA channels eliminate processor bottlenecks during peripheral-to-memory transfers. For secure data transfers, the SAM7XC is available with a hardware AES encryption accelerator and a Triple Data Encryption System.
Key Features
Extensive peripherals, uncompromised data rate — Featuring an extensive peripheral set that includes 10/100 Ethernet MAC, CAN, USB 2.0, USART, SPI, SSC, TWI, 8-channel 10-bit ADC. Architectured to maximize processor performance and data transfer efficiency.
Hardware Encryption/Decryption — Embedded AES and Triple DES function at rates of 80 Mbps for AES, 32.8 Mbps for DES and 20 Mbps for triple DES.
Highly integrated design reduces costs and BOM — Combining the ARM7TDMI processor with on-chip Flash and SRAM, power and reset management, and a wide range of peripheral functions on a single, integrated chip provides maximum flexibility, while minimizing the need for expensive additional components. The result is a streamlined bill of materials (BOM), faster development, and reduced cost.
Comprehensive ecosystem and tools — To help speed development, SAM7X/XC microcontrollers are fully supported by a worldwide ecosystem of industry-leading suppliers of development tools, operating systems and protocol stacks.
